Demi’s cover photo mystery deepens

Demi Moore

METRO WORLD NEWS
November 26, 2009 1:22 a.m.
       Text size          
The scandal brewing over whether Demi Moore’s photo on the cover of W was doctored has reached a new level. The blog Pop Culture Madness has uncovered evidence that they claim proves Moore’s head was simply attached to the body of 26-year-old model Anja Rubik. Moore, who was vocal about the scandal before via her Twitter account, has yet to address the latest claims.
